Extension Amount definition

Extension Amount has the meaning given to such term in Section 3.09 hereof.
Extension Amount means 110% of the sum of (a) the outstanding principal amount of this Debenture at the expiration of the original Maturity Date, plus (b) accrued and unpaid interest thereon at the expiration of the original Maturity Date, plus (c) all other amounts, costs, expenses and liquidated damages due in respect of this Debenture at the expiration of the original Maturity Date.
Extension Amount means the product of (i) $[ ] multiplied by [(ii) a fraction, the numerator of which is the sum of the number of Initial Equity Trust Securities and Additional Equity Trust Securities and the denominator of which is the number of Initial Equity Trust Securities, multiplied by] (iii) a fraction, the numerator of which is the sum of the Firm Share Base Amount and the Additional Share Base Amount and the denominator of which is the number of Initial Equity Trust Securities and Additional Equity Trust Securities.

More Definitions of Extension Amount

Extension Amount means, with respect to a Permitted Sale Transaction, either the IM Parks Extension Amount or the PFC Extension Amount, as the context may require.
Extension Amount means the amount, which, pursuant to the SPAC Certificate of Incorporation, the Sponsor shall deposit, or cause to be deposited, into the Trust Account in the form of a non-interest bearing loan in order to extend the deadline for SPAC to consummate its initial business combination by three months to May 18, 2023.
Extension Amount means 105% of the sum of (a) the outstanding principal amount of this Debenture at the expiration of the original Maturity Date, plus (b) accrued and unpaid interest thereon at the expiration of the original Maturity Date, plus (c) all other amounts, costs, expenses and liquidated damages due in respect of this Debenture at the expiration of the original Maturity Date.

Extension Amount means as of any measurement time, the aggregate amount deposited by the Sponsor, or its affiliates or designees to the Trust Account to extend the period of time SPAC shall have to consummate an initial Business Combination (as defined in the SPAC Amended and Restated Certificate of Incorporation) pursuant to Section 9.1(c) of the SPAC Amended and Restated Certificate of Incorporation.
